Transaction 8a91faf6acbca463908496d1e1825ae5771775bddad811841b6578c9e2169240
1 Input
1 Output
-
8a91faf6acbca463908496d1e1825ae5771775bddad811841b6578c9e2169240:0
- value
- 4572731
- script pubkey
- OP_0 OP_PUSHBYTES_32 71c10e684f90c65b8bf735b6058ff33d01a17dcb40f2c6538a50400d32cbb09c
- address
- bc1qw8qsu6z0jrr9hzlhxkmqtrln85q6zlwtgrevv5u22pqq6vktkzwqqxju2u